Huston J Joyner 1922 - 2006

Huston J Joyner of Port Jefferson Station, Suffolk County, NY was born on June 22, 1922, and died at age 84 years old on October 15, 2006. Huston Joyner was buried at Calverton National Cemetery Section 32 Site 415 210 Princeton Boulevard - Rt 25, in Calverton.

Did you know?
In 1922, in the year that Huston J Joyner was born, on June 22, coal miners in Herrin Illinois, were on strike (coal miners had been on strike nationally since April 1). The striking miners were outraged at the strikebreakers (scabs) that the company had brought in and laid siege to the mine. Three union workers were killed when gunfire was exchanged. The next day, union miners killed 23 strikebreakers and mine guards. No one, on either side, ever faced jail time.
Did you know?
In 1934, when this person was only 12 years old, on July 22nd, gangster John Dillinger was killed in Chicago. His gang had robbed banks and police stations, among other charges, and he was being hunted by J. Edgar Hoover, head of the FBI - although many in the public saw him as a "Robin Hood". A madam from a brothel in which he was hiding became an informer for the FBI and, after a shootout with FBI agents, Dillinger was shot and died.
